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Apple-blossom Weevil | Checkered Woodpecker |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Coleoptera (Beetles) | Piciformes (Piciformes) |
| Family | Curculionidae | Picidae |
| Genus | Anthonomus | Veniliornis |
| Species | Anthonomus pomorum | Veniliornis mixtus |
Evolutionary Relationship
Apple-blossom Weevil and Checkered Woodpecker share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
